Tri Star Resources : Antimony Concentration 99.5% & Gold …

The SPMP Project is the largest antimony roaster outside of China and the world's first 'Clean Plant', designed to EU environmental standards. It has a targeted capacity to produce in excess of 50,000 oz. of gold and 20,000 tonnes in combined antimony metal and antimony trioxide ("ATO") per annum.

Three Methods To Antimony Ore Beneficiation And Processing

Since antimony deposits are often produced in the form of coarse single crystals or massive aggregate crystals, hand-selecting can often get high-grade bulk antimony concentrates, which are suitable for the technical requirements of vertical roasting furnaces in antimony metallurgical plants.

METALLURGY | usantimony

Volatilization Roasting is the process of volatilizing the sulfur and forming antimony crude oxide (Sb2O3) Sb2S3 +9O→Sb2O3+3 SO2; begins at 290°, rapid at 520° and finishes at 560° (Saito); begins at 290°, if the size of the grain is 0·1 mm. in diameter, at 343° of 0·1 to 0·2 mm., and 430° if 0·2 mm.
